Default '09 Limited slip vs Advancetrac/RSC

Hello to all on the forum. This is my first post but I've been enjoying all the good info on this site. Thanks.

I'm nearing the pickup date for my new '09 F-150 XLT 4.6 4X 6spA 3.53 diff and will be retiring my '92 Flairside 4X (140k) in the swap. That makes this my 4th F-150; 78, 84, 92 and now 09.

Does anyone have first hand experience with the A-trac system in operation on the road or off? I asked the salesman about an L/S diff but I couldn't find it in the 4.6L config, only w/5.4L. He said the A-trac will do the job of the L/S diff. Was he pulling a work on me? I think so cause doesn't the A-track sys need body roll to kick in? I don't know that I'll miss an L/S diff in the truck but have enjoyed the performance of an L/S diff in our 97 Explorer ( V6 SOC w 224k and going strong).
